How they compare
Africa currently reports 496.17 million BoP, current US$ against 15.22 million BoP, current US$ in Cape Verde, a difference of 480.95 million BoP, current US$.
That makes Africa's figure about 32.6 times Cape Verde's.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 52 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Cape Verde ahead.
Africa ranks 2nd and Cape Verde ranks 4th of 6 groups.
Cape Verde has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.

About this data
Net long-term borrowing includes external debt disbursements less repayments due, plus other net long-term inflows. Data are in current U.S. dollars.
